BELLE SHAFFER IS TAKEN BY DEATH Lifelong resident of This Community Dies Tuesday After a Brief Illness Mrs. Isabelle Shaffer, aged 85 years, died Tuesday morning at 4:30 in the home of her son Hollis E. Shaffer, southwest of Metamora, after a brief illness. Mrs. Shaffer was born August 31, 1860, in Ai and spent all of her life in this community. She was one of seven sisters, two of whom survive her. Her husband, Peter Shaffer, to whom she was married February 20, 1881, died September 20, 1928. Two sons, Claud and Harry, also preceded her in death. She was a member many years of the Bethany Sunday school class of the Metamora Methodist church. Besides her son she is survived by a grandson, Pvt. Charles Shaffer of the U. S. Army Air Corps, home on furlough from Fort Myers, Fla. and sisters, Mrs. Delilah Smith of Swanton and Mrs. Alice Gordonier of Delta. Funeral services are being held this afternoon at 2:00 o'clock in the Biehl-Malone Funeral Home, with Rev. J. L. Peck officiating. Burial is being made in Amboy Cemetery. (Second Obituary) ____________________________ Mrs P. J. Shaffer, 84 years of age, and mother of County Commissioner Hollis Shaffer, died at her home in Amboy township, Tuesday. She was one of the fine pioneer Christian women of that township. Nearly all her life was spent on the home farm near Metamora. Her husband passed away a number of years ago since which time she has made her home with her son.
